Abstract

We consider the Dirac equation in curved backgrounds and investigate the role of Killing-Yano tensors in constructing Dirac-type operators. The general results are applied to the case of the four-dimensional Euclidean Taub-NUT space. We investigate the gravitational anomalies for generalized Euclidean Taub-NUT metrics that admit hidden symmetries analogous to the Runge-Lenz vector of the Kepler-type problem.
